Abstract

1445543 Cams; converting rotary into reciprocating motion FERNSTEUERGERATE KURT OELSCH KG 5 April 1974 [10 April 1973] 15279/74 Heading F2K A radially extending adjustable contour spiral cam 22 of a disc 12 fast on a rotatable input shaft 10 acts via a pivoted rocker arm 26, or a radially slidable cam follower (50, 72) (Figs. 3 and 4, not shown) to linearly move a member 40 forming the input member of an inductive displacement pick-up 42. The angular displacement of the shaft 10 may, according to the readily adjustable cam contour 24, transform the angular displacement of the shaft 10 into a linear displacement of the member 40 which is related proportionally, i.e. according to a linear function, or according to any other predetermined, i.e. ncn-linear function, to said angular displacement. As shown (Fig. 5 and Figs. 6 and 7, not shown) the adjustable contour spiral cam is formed by a flexible steel strip 84 arranged over a number of eccentrically adjustable support pins 80, the strip 84 being secured at one end 86 and tensioned over the pins 80 by a spring 90 at its other end. Screw driver slots 82 formed in the ends of the pins 80 enable the pins 80 to be eccentrically adjusted to adjust the spiral cam contour of the flexible strip to any required form within the limits of the eccentric support pins 80. In Figs. 8 to 10 the flexible strip 84 is replaced by a wire (94) seated in V-grooves (96) formed in the eccentric adjuster studs 80. In Figs. 11 and 12 (not shown) the flexible cam contour strip or wire is carried by mountings (176) radially adjustable in slots in the cam disc by the eccentrically ended pins.
